<p class="MsoNormal" style="background:white;vertical-align:baseline"><span style="font-size:12.0pt;font-family:"Franklin Gothic Book",sans-serif;color:#444444">Therefore, I recommend colleges send teams to the ATL and employ a “divide and conquer” approach.<br>
<br>
As participants attend sessions, they build up their individual assessment literacy.  When they return to the group and share what they’ve learned (there will be time for this during a “sensemaking” final session of the conference, titled, “Wait!  Don’t Leave
 Yet!”), the collective assessment literacy of the attending group is bolstered substantially.  When they return to campus, they can provide “sensegiving” experiences to their colleagues unable to attend the conference.<o:p></o:p></span></p>
<p style="mso-margin-top-alt:0in;margin-right:0in;margin-bottom:20.4pt;margin-left:0in;background:white;vertical-align:baseline">
<span style="font-family:"Franklin Gothic Book",sans-serif;color:#444444"><br>
My supervisor and trusted mentor, Bill Moore, calls this “Broadening and Deepening,” and it is one of the most useful benefits of attending the upcoming 2018 ATL Conference.<o:p></o:p></span></p>
